Proper noun

edit

Maastrichtian

  1. The dialect of the Limburgish language as spoken in Maastricht
  2. (geology) in the ICS geologic timescale, the last stage or age of the Cretaceous period, and of the Mesozoic era, preceded by the Campanian and succeeded by the Danian period.
